Cellulite-Removal Apparel:
Hosiery, Shoes, and Clothes
Since women have had to deal with cellulite, they
have been looking for ways to eliminate it. One of the strangest ways
I’ve seen is through the use of apparel
designed to rid your body of cellulite. Many of these garments and wraps
come with tall promises that just don’t seem to deliver. How many of
these have you
tried?
Compression hosiery designed to
minimize the appearance of
cellulite can sound promising but you’re not really repairing the
problem.
Stretchy fabric that is soaked in
different herbs and then whatever
the wraps don’t absorb, the remainder is poured on the thighs and
buttocks and then the wet, soaking wraps are placed tightly around the
cellulite affected areas, basically what you wind up with is a lower
body that smells like an herbal air freshener and you still have your
cellulite problem.
Anti-cellulite shorts are another
hot item on the body improvement
market. They are basically spandex exercise shorts that come with a
cream that you apply and then wear the shorts. The idea is that the
shorts fit tight enough to force the cream into the cellulite affected
areas.
Again, you’re not attacking the cellulite problem at
its source, so you’re not going to see good results. You’ll most likely
notice that your thigh skin is more soft and supple from the cream,
which then hydrates your outer layer of skin from being kept in the
shorts and not allowing the cream to evaporate quickly. But the
cellulite remains, because the cream cannot penetrate through to the
layer of cellulite under the skin.
Cellulite-treating shoes work on the
principle that proper posture and walking techniques are beneficial to
your body, which as we know is true. However, they also claim that their
shoes will melt fat deposits and even reduce varicose veins. This is
simply untrue. There’s no way for the shoes to thermogenically burn fat
and rid the toxins that cause cellulite.
